Looking for breakthrough ideas for innovation challenges? Try Patsnap Eureka!

RS (Reed-Solomon) decoding device and method for 10G Ethernet Passive Optical Network (EPON)

A decoding device and equation solving technology, applied in digital transmission systems, electrical components, error prevention, etc., can solve problems such as data rate inconsistency, circuit throughput not meeting requirements, etc.

Active Publication Date: 2012-07-04
北京格林伟迪科技股份有限公司 +1
View PDF2 Cites 4 Cited by
  • Summary
  • Abstract
  • Description
  • Claims
  • Application Information

AI Technical Summary

Problems solved by technology

As a result, the throughput rate of the above-mentioned pulsating structure circuit cannot meet the requirements. If the clock frequency is increased, it will not coordinate with the data rate, which will cause many problems.

Method used

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
View more

Image

Smart Image Click on the blue labels to locate them in the text.
Viewing Examples
Smart Image
  • RS (Reed-Solomon) decoding device and method for 10G Ethernet Passive Optical Network (EPON)
  • RS (Reed-Solomon) decoding device and method for 10G Ethernet Passive Optical Network (EPON)
  • RS (Reed-Solomon) decoding device and method for 10G Ethernet Passive Optical Network (EPON)

Examples

Experimental program
Comparison scheme
Effect test

Embodiment Construction

[0114] When the traditional serial pulsation structure is used to implement the ME algorithm, the polynomials are sequentially moved into the decoding pipeline structure in a serial manner. For the RS (255, 223) code, there are 32 syndromes, so 32 clock cycles are required to be introduced into the pipeline. In 10GEPON, each FEC data block occupies 31 clock cycles, and the corresponding syndrome is updated every 31 clock cycles, so the serial pulsation structure cannot meet the throughput requirement. In addition, the serial mode also needs to increase parallel-to-serial and serial-to-parallel conversion circuits to increase circuit resources.

[0115] Aiming at the problems existing in the prior art, the present invention adopts a parallel calculation method, completes an iterative calculation in each clock cycle, and reuses a set of circuits for multiple iterative calculations, thus solving the problem of the introduction of pulsating structure syndromes, and does not requir...

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

PUM

No PUM Login to View More

Abstract

The invention provides an RS (Reed-Solomon) decoding device for a 10G Ethernet passive optical network (EPON), which comprises a receiving buffer module, a corrector calculating module, a key equation solution module, a Chien search and error value calculating module, a delay buffer module and a sending buffer module. The invention also provides an RS decoding method for the 10G EPON. According to the invention, the coordination of RS decoding and the data rate can be realized and the multibyte parallel processing is realized.

Description

technical field [0001] The present invention relates to the technical field of Ethernet Passive Optical Network (EPON), in particular to an RS decoding device and method for 10G EPON. Background technique [0002] RS code, also known as Lisuo code, namely Reed-Solomon code, is a kind of forward error correction channel coding. The encoding process involves first redundanting the polynomial resulting from correcting the oversampled data at multiple points before transmitting or storing it. Sampling the polynomial beyond necessary values ​​makes the polynomial overdetermined (overqualified). When the receiver receives enough points correctly, it can recover the original polynomial, even if the received polynomial has many points distorted by noise. [0003] The 10G Ethernet Passive Optical Network (EPON) standard requires RS (255, 223) forward error correction coding on the line to improve the signal-to-noise ratio. RS decoding is mainly divided into syndrome calculation, k...

Claims

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

Application Information

Patent Timeline
no application Login to View More
IPC IPC(8): H04L1/00
Inventor 陈雪李西聪高卫东王磊聂克庆
Owner 北京格林伟迪科技股份有限公司
Who we serve
  • R&D Engineer
  • R&D Manager
  • IP Professional
Why Patsnap Eureka
  • Industry Leading Data Capabilities
  • Powerful AI technology
  • Patent DNA Extraction
Social media
Patsnap Eureka Blog
Learn More
PatSnap group products